Executive Summary
The Challenge
Digital disruption has had a major impact on the world of marketing and advertising. As competition and customer expectations increased, the delivery cycle of product enhancements for IPG’s business- critical SAP systems was perceived internally as being out of touch and too slow to respond. A new way of working was required, but a highly dispersed global team, stringent compliance requirements and a regular flow of new business acquisitions made this already complex challenge all the more difficult.
Like many businesses confronted with digital disruption IPG has faced a range of new challenges in recent years. “Marketing has drastically changed due to an explosion of new communication channels, devices, and technologies,” explains Orhan Ozalp, Executive Director, Global SAP Solutions at IPG. “Suddenly we have competitors like Google and Facebook that we never competed with in the past.”
IPG realized that their traditional SAP release cycle, consisting of one major and one minor production deployment per year, was no longer fit for purpose in this new market; a more agile, low-cost approach to IT was required. However, their change control processes, which were based on extensive use of Excel spreadsheets, could not be accelerated without exposing critical financial systems to an unacceptable level of risk (and associated cost of failure).
The Solution
IPG decided to embark on a DevOps project that would make their SAP systems more responsive without putting the business at risk. Basis Technologies has supported IPG’s business for a number of years. Thanks to this close working relationship IPG were already aware of Basis Technologies’ expertise in DevOps for SAP.
ActiveControl from Basis Technologies was selected to support this initiative and enable IPG to move from bi-annual releases to weekly deployments. With ActiveControl, IPG can “really, truly be agile and change things” in their SAP systems and are “just continuously delivering”.
ActiveControl also removes the delay caused by differences in time zones, languages, etc by making it easy for every team to see the progress of any change. A browser-based web user interface even provides access to the system from any location.
The Result
ActiveControl’s advanced automation functions underpin IPG’s DevOps approach and have eliminated the use of Excel spreadsheets from their change and release processes. All change requests and associated transports are now controlled in a single repository, with automatic deployment of transports on a set schedule. By shifting away from spreadsheets, the IPG team significantly reduced the risk of error and freed up a wealth of manual resource to focus on value-add activities.
Customized workflows have been defined to support IPG’s business needs, including both business and IT approvals. This automation has helped to increase team productivity and deliver greater business value by enabling promotion of change into SAP production systems as soon as it’s ready.
The advanced analysis provided by ActiveControl has dramatically reduced the risk of SAP change at IPG, where its suite of more than sixty out-of-the-box analyzers is employed to eliminate costly production downtime by identifying issues at the earliest possible stage. This increased confidence in the quality of change supports faster, more frequent deployments and helps to raise team morale by eliminating the need for ‘out of hours’ deployment windows and development of emergency fixes.
Finally, by acting as a ‘single source of truth’, ActiveControl massively reduces the time and effort it takes the IPG team to analyze SAP changes and produce the audit reports needed for regulatory compliance (e.g. SOX).
